Jude is a Philippine attorney specializing in mergers and acquisitions, corporate law and tax. Jude has assisted a number of global and ASEAN multinationals in multi-jurisdictional reorganizations and has advised many clients on complex mergers and acquisitions.
He holds a Master of Laws degree from Harvard University where he received the Ayala Scholarship Grant, the Lopez Scholarship Grant and the Landon H. Gammon Fellowship for Academic Excellence. He also earned a Master of Business Administration degree (Finance and Supply Chain Management) from UNC-Chapel Hill’s Kenan-Flagler Business School where he was a UNC Kenan-Flagler Fellow. He is a graduate of and a former professorial lecturer on tax law and constitutional law at the University of the Philippines College of Law.
A corporate and tax lawyer with almost two decades of experience in the Philippines and abroad, Jude held senior director or partner positions in several Big 4 firms in the Philippines (KPMG), Central Asia (Deloitte) and in Europe (E&Y). He was a regional tax director and deputy head of regional tax of DFDL, an international law firm focusing on high-growth Asian markets.
He also served in the Philippine government. From 2004 to 2005, he was Assistant Secretary for Legal Affairs of the Republic’s Trade and Industry Department and Finance Department.
He writes on competition law for Lexis Nexis and tax law for IBFD. He also contributes to the Linklaters global data privacy protection guide. He has also been named by Asia Business Law Journal as one of the Top 100 Lawyers of the Philippines from 2020 to 2025. He has also been recognized as Commended External Counsel by In-House Community from 2023 to 2025.
